Responsibilities of the Conflicts Analyst role include: - Analyzing and processing conflict requests to ensure business and ethical clearance - Conducting corporate research to identify related parties and address potential conflicts - Interacting with partners to investigate and discuss potential issues and propose solutions - Maintaining conflicts resolution notes and responses for each request - Drafting conflict waivers and engagement letters when necessary - Providing conflicts training for staff members - Staying updated on current legal trends and information - Conducting conflicts case law and legal ethics research - Implementing ethical screens as needed Requirements for the Conflicts Analyst role include: - Availability to work overtime, including weekends if necessary - Proficiency in IntApp Open and Contract Express or similar programs - Knowledge of legal ethics and corporate law practice - 2+ years of applicable experience in a legal environment or conflicts department - Bachelor's degree or JD strongly preferred - Paralegal certificate or completion of an ethics course in a paralegal program preferred - Prior experience as a paralegal or legal researcher in a law firm Cooley values its employees and offers a comprehensive benefits package, including medical, dental, vision, and parental support benefits. With a strong focus on work-life balance, Cooley also provides 20 days of Paid Time Off and 10 paid holidays each year, as well as generous parental leave and fertility benefits.
